Net Metering

Net Metering is a billing arrangement whereby owners of rooftop and other small-scale solar receive a 1:1 credit for the excess energy their systems generate and send back to the electric grid.

These credits from when the sun is shining automatically offset your energy bill at later times, such as at night or in winter months when their solar panels are less productive. Those credits are good for an entire year. This is how solar installations “pay for themselves” over time, and it’s what makes solar financially accessible to homeowners, farmers and small businesses.

Net metering is the foundation for distributed generation and allows rooftop solar to be built with the goal of meeting the owner’s annual needs. You do not need to sign up or do any additional work to take advantage of this arrangement.

Why Net Metering is at Risk

However, in May 2025, Dominion Energy petitioned the State Corporation Commission to cut the net metering credit by nearly half. Why? Because monopoly utilities like Dominion make maximum revenue from centralized, utility-scale generation — like gas plants and large-scale solar — and infrastructure like transmission lines. Motivated by profits, Dominion’s tremendous lobbying pressure has been a longstanding and powerful force against efforts to create a more distributed grid that would allow more homeowners and businesses to go solar and create energy independence for themselves.

Dominion’s efforts would have severely undermined the practicality of rooftop solar for many people and critically hampered the viability of increased distributed energy generation and energy independence at a time when skyrocketing data center energy demands are straining the grid, Virginia is importing more energy than ever and more than any other state, and electric bills are increasing.

PEC served as an “intervenor” in this case, joining our partners to challenge Dominion’s arguments, pose questions and offer additional information for SCC’s consideration. Fortunately, in May 2026, The State Corporation Commission (SCC) ruled that net metering will remain unchanged!

Report Finds Solar Far Exceeds Value Communicated by Dominion

In 2025, PEC commissioned Dunsky Energy + Climate Advisors to study and calculate the actual value of distributed solar generation in Dominion Energy’s territory — factoring in the range of benefits (such as land conservation, connecting clean energy quickly and mitigating new transmission and generation impacts) that the utility did not account for in its proposed cuts to net metering values. The report, written to be relevant and readable, formed the foundation of PEC’s formal “intervention” when the SCC considered Dominion’s proposal.

Our analysis demonstrated that small-scale distributed solar delivers substantial value that far exceeds what Dominion acknowledged in its proposed net metering framework.

Small-scale, distributed solar must play a greater part in Virginia’s energy future. These projects — rooftop solar, parking lot solar, solar on landfills, and dual-use agrivoltaics — bring clean energy to the grid much faster than utility-scale energy generation with lower needs for new transmission and generation, which we all pay for through our utility bills.

Small-scale solar (on rooftops and parking lots) provides immense value by bringing clean energy online quickly and reducing the need for expensive new transmission lines and large-scale power plants — projects that take years to develop with costs that are ultimately passed down to all ratepayers.

By incentivizing small-scale solar through fair net metering, Virginia can meet its renewable energy goals while protecting working farmlands and open spaces from being converted into massive, utility-scale solar arrays. Emerging practices, like dual-use agrivoltaics that combine agriculture and solar production, also benefit from net metering credits.

Virginia currently imports more electricity than any other state. At a time when data centers are putting unprecedented strain on our infrastructure, it’s important to encourage distributed energy generation that builds a more resilient and self-sufficient local power grid.
